Funding for NSW businesses to install new submeters
Submetering Grants NSW
This program provides funding to NSW businesses to help them install and commission permanent energy submeters.

What do you get?
Grants of up to $20,000, to cover up to 50% of project costs.
Who is this for?
NSW businesses that spend a minimum of $200,000 a year on energy bills.
Overview
This program aims to help NSW businesses purchase and install new submeters to measure energy performance.
Funding can be used for:
- installing and commissioning permanent submeters that are required for measuring energy performance
- hardware and integration with software required for energy monitoring.
Check if you can apply
To be eligible, you must:
- have an Australian business number (ABN)
- be registered for goods and services tax (GST)
- deliver your submetering project at a NSW site address
- spend a minimum of $200,000 annually on energy bills at your business site, or demonstrate an equivalent annual on-site energy use of at least 3,600 gigajoules (GJ).
